在这个数字时代,增强现实(AR)技术已经渗透到我们的日常生活中,从游戏到教育,从零售到医疗,AR的应用越来越广泛。你是否也想要创作出属于自己的炫酷AR作品?别担心,从零开始,只要掌握一些基本的技巧,你也可以轻松创作出令人惊叹的AR作品。下面,就让我带你一步步走进AR创作的世界。
了解AR技术基础
首先,我们需要了解什么是AR技术。增强现实(Augmented Reality,简称AR)是一种将虚拟信息叠加到现实世界中的技术。简单来说,就是通过摄像头捕捉现实场景,然后在屏幕上叠加虚拟物体或信息,让用户感受到虚拟物体仿佛真的存在于现实世界中。
AR技术原理
AR技术主要依赖于以下三个关键技术:
- 摄像头捕捉:通过摄像头捕捉现实场景,获取真实世界的图像信息。
- 图像识别:利用图像识别技术,将捕捉到的图像与预先设定的目标进行匹配,确定虚拟物体的位置和方向。
- 叠加显示:将虚拟物体叠加到现实场景中,形成增强现实效果。
常用的AR开发平台
目前,市面上有许多AR开发平台,以下是一些常用的平台:
- ARKit:苹果公司开发的AR开发平台,适用于iOS设备。
- ARCore:谷歌公司开发的AR开发平台,适用于Android设备。
- Unity AR Foundation:Unity引擎提供的AR开发工具包,适用于多种平台。
学习AR创作技巧
掌握了AR技术基础后,接下来就是学习AR创作技巧了。以下是一些实用的技巧,帮助你轻松创作出炫酷的AR作品。
1. 确定创作主题
在开始创作之前,首先要确定你的创作主题。这可以是任何你感兴趣的事物,如游戏、教育、艺术等。
2. 选择合适的开发工具
根据你的创作主题和目标平台,选择合适的AR开发工具。例如,如果你想要开发iOS设备上的AR应用,可以选择ARKit;如果你想要开发Android设备上的AR应用,可以选择ARCore。
3. 学习编程语言和开发环境
AR开发通常需要一定的编程基础。以下是一些常用的编程语言和开发环境:
- 编程语言:Swift(iOS)、Java/Kotlin(Android)、C#(Unity)
- 开发环境:Xcode(iOS)、Android Studio(Android)、Unity
4. 设计AR场景
在设计AR场景时,要注意以下几点:
- 场景布局:合理安排虚拟物体在现实场景中的位置和大小。
- 交互设计:设计合理的交互方式,让用户能够与虚拟物体进行互动。
- 视觉效果:注意虚拟物体的材质、纹理和光影效果,使其更加真实。
5. 测试和优化
在完成AR作品后,要进行充分的测试和优化。确保作品在不同设备和场景下都能正常运行,并不断调整和优化,提升用户体验。
总结
通过以上介绍,相信你已经对AR创作有了初步的了解。从零开始,只要掌握一些基本的技巧,你也可以轻松创作出炫酷的AR作品。快来发挥你的创意,开启你的AR创作之旅吧!
